Throbbing Gristle Dead Souls

This song fits my creative expression these days.

Please listen while viewing zombie pictures.  Sorry if it is too disturbing.

They say God doesn’t give you anything you cannot handle.  But it isn’t always God that does the giving.

They say if life gives you lemons make lemonade but  What if life gives you a steaming pile of crap?  Should you still make lemonade?

They say that if you stop looking for love it will find you.  What happens if it doesn’t?

Zombies.  Is the only answer I have for these deep and thought provoking questions.



